North Dakota Statutes

§ 12.1-15-04 — Definitions

North Dakota·Title 12.1 Criminal Code·Ch. 12.1-15 Defamation - Interception of Communications

In sections 12.1-15-02 through 12.1-15-04:

1."Communications common carrier" shall have the meaning prescribed for the term "common carrier" by section 8-07-01.
2."Contents", when used with respect to any wire or oral communication, includes any information concerning the identity of the parties to such communication or the existence, substance, purport, or meaning of that communication.
3."Electronic, mechanical, or other device" means any device or apparatus which can be used to intercept a wire or oral communication other than:
